Virginia SB 153 (2020) — Virginia Freedom of Information Act; cost estimates, response time.

Virginia Freedom of Information Act; cost estimates; response time. Provides that if a requester asks for a cost estimatein advance of a Virginia Freedom of Information Act request, thetime to respond is tolled for the amount of time that elapses between notice of the cost estimate and the response from the requester,and that if the public body receives no response from the requesterwithin 30 days of sending the cost estimate, the request shall bedeemed to be withdrawn. The bill clarifies that if a cost estimateexceeds $200 and the public body requires an advance deposit, thepublic body may require the requester to pay the advance depositbefore the public body is required to process the request. This billis a recommendation of the Virginia Freedom of Information Advisory Council.
